  • Patent number: 10367590
    Abstract: Examples described herein relate to concurrently performing operations on optical signals. In an example, a method includes providing, to an optical circuit, a first plurality of signals having a first optical property and encoding a first vector. A second plurality of signals is provided to the circuit that encodes a second vector and has a second optical property that is different from the first optical property. A first attribute-dependent operation is performed on the first plurality of signals via the circuit to perform a first matrix multiplication operation on the first vector, and concurrently, a second attribute-dependent operation is performed on the second plurality of signals to perform a second matrix multiplication operation on the second vector. The first matrix multiplication operation and the second matrix multiplication operation are different based on the first optical property being different from the second optical property.

  • Patent number: 4869817
    Abstract: A valve structure for a swimming pool water filter includes:(a) a hollow body having multiple flow apertures,(b) a rotary plate on the body and having flow porting, the plate being movable toward and away from said flow apertures,(c) seal means between the body and plate,(d) a handle having operative connection to the plate to rotate said plate to bring said plate porting into and out of selected registration with said flow apertures,(e) and means mounting the handle to pivot without rotating the plate, and between a first position in which the handle has moved the plate to energize the seal means to seal off between the body and plate, and a second position in which the handle has moved the plate to de-energized said seal means.

  • Patent number: 4556933
    Abstract: In an underwater pool or spa light assembly for retaining an annular lens gasket and light housing in position, comprises:(a) a face ring having a central axis and annular re-entrant wall defining an annular flared portion to seat the gasket assembly, the ring also having retainer structure to retain said light housing which is engageable with the gasket to annularly compress same axially,(b) and circularly spaced tabs on the ring and projecting generally axially beyond the edge of the annularly flared portion to peripherally position the gasket, blocking radially outward extrusion thereof when compressed by the housing.

  • Patent number: 4460944
    Abstract: A light unit assembly adapted to illuminate liquid below a liquid surface (for example of a pool or spa) includes(a) a lamp unit including a metallic housing adapted to be cooled by heat transfer to the liquid, and lamp circuitry,(b) a thermostat coupled to the lamp circuitry to control electrical energization of the lamp, and(c) a heat conductive metallic strip associated with said housing and thermostat to become increasingly heated for changing the conductive state of the lamp in response to diminished cooling of the housing by said liquid.
